WebApr 14, 2024 · The stamp duty on electronic share purchases is 0.5 per cent and is normally collected automatically as part of a transaction fee. With traditional paper share certificates, stamp duty is also charged at 0.5 per cent on transactions valued at more than £1,000. This is rounded up to the nearest £5. WebWho Should Pay Stamp Duty. Check the terms of the document (e.g. tenancy agreement) to determine who is contractually required to pay the stamp duty. When the terms do not state who is liable, the party to pay stamp duty will follow that as specified in the Third Schedule of the Stamp Duties Act.
